Bitcoin treasury company Strive acquires Web3 media platform MSTR True North
Jinse Finance reported that Strive, a Nasdaq-listed Bitcoin treasury company, announced the acquisition of the Web3 media platform MSTR True North, including its Bitcoin podcast and distribution channels. The specific acquisition amount has not been disclosed. It is reported that after the transaction is completed, True North founder Jeff Walton will become Strive's Chief Risk Officer. Strive previously disclosed that it holds 69 BTC and has launched a $450 million share offering to further increase its Bitcoin holdings.
